Mitigating non-genetic resistance to checkpoint inhibition based on multiple states of immune exhaustion
Irina Kareva,
Jana Gevertz
Abstract:Despite the revolutionary impact of immune checkpoint inhibition on cancer therapy, the lack of response in a subset of patients, as well as the emergence of resistance, remain significant challenges. Here we explore the theoretical consequences of the existence of multiple states of immune cell exhaustion on response to checkpoint inhibition therapy.
